Is INLAND ENVIRONMENTAL RESOURCES INC safe to load? INLAND ENVIRONMENTAL RESOURCES INC (USDOT 1592696, MC-602596) is an active asset-based motor carrier based in PASCO, WA, operating 18 power units and 16 drivers. Operating authority has been active 19 years (past the 24-month broker-confidence threshold). Across 20 roadside inspections, its vehicle out-of-service rate is 28.6% (above the 22.26% national average), with 1 reportable crash in the last 24 months. FMCSA rates it Satisfactory. Vektor rates it review before loading (75/100), with the leading concern: no active operating authority. Source: FMCSA SAFER/MCMIS, last updated 2026-06-26.
